The Creek Nation was a part of the Indian Territory census, not the Oklahoma Territory census. Be aware, too, that the northeastern part of Tulsa was in the Cherokee Nation. I would recommend that, if possible, you search for the household using the Soundex for 1900 Indian Territory, available on microfilm.
